It is the Gateway Arch in St. Louis, Missouri is one of the most well-known structures across the United States and in the world because it stands at 630 feet high and the width is 630 feet from base to the base. It was constructed between 1963 and 1965 and then was opened for public viewing in the year 1967. in 1967, the Gateway Arch was a beautiful structure that is a major visitor attraction within St. Louis that allows visitors to climb through the top to an observation point for stunning views that can stretch up to 30 miles in a single day. It is the Gateway Arch is the symbol for the city of St. Louis, Missouri.
San Jacinto Monument San Jacinto Monument is located in San Jacinto State Park in La Porte, Texas just east of Houston. This monument honors the “Heroes from the battle of San Jacinto and all others who helped to establish the independence from Texas.” San Jacinto Monument San Jacinto Monument is 570 feet tall and weighs 70 million pounds. It covers around 125 square feet in the base and stretches in size to 30 sq. feet on the top, where there is a 34-foot tall lone star.
The monument was constructed at the time of the Great Depression by the Public Works Administration between 1936 and 1939. It is a major site for tourists in Houston that is visited by more than 250,000 visitors each year. Tourists can ride the elevator to the top to enjoy stunning views.
